This manipulation was helpful before the change of secondary positions qualifying for the mandatory required draft positions when putting a team together in the draft center.
One example is in a Progressive League where I took over a team in the We Aren't Dead Yet Progressive League, WADY. The Los Angeles Platypi.
I believe for the 1973 season I had 4 players who had a fielding grade for 3B, but none that had 3B as their primary position.
At that time the draft center would not allow that team to be entered, because there was no Third Baseman.
Joe Torre had been my starting Third Baseman for the 1972 season, but for 1973 although he qualified at 3B, his primary position was 1B.
With the knowledge of this manipulation I could enter the team by Having any player fill the 3B slot.
